How to login to MyFiosGateway.com?
Access your Verizon router’s web interface using these steps:
- Connect your computer to the Verizon router via Ethernet cable or by joining the wireless network.
- Open your web browser (Chrome, Firefox, Safari, or Edge).
- Type http://myfiosgateway.com or http://192.168.1.1 in the address bar and press Enter.
- Enter the login username admin and password when prompted.
The default password is typically printed on a sticker attached to your Verizon FiOS router.
- Click Log In to access the router administration panel.
How to Change Wi-Fi name(SSID) and password?
Once logged into your Verizon router admin panel at at myfiosgateway.com, you can modify wireless settings:
- Navigate to Wireless Settings on the top of main page.
- In the Basic section, locate the Wi-Fi name(SSID) field to change your WiFi network name.
- Find the Wi-Fi Password field to update your wireless password.
- Select WPA2 or WPA3 encryption for optimal security.
- Click Save to confirm changes.
- Wait for the router to restart and apply the new configuration.
Troubleshooting MyFiosGateway Access Issues
If you cannot access myfiosgateway.com, try these solutions:
- Verify your computer is connected to the Verizon router’s network
- Try the alternative IP address 192.168.1.1 instead of myfiosgateway.com
- Clear your browser cache and cookies
- Disable any VPN connections that might interfere
- Test with a different web browser
- Ensure the router is powered on and functioning properly
- Use an Ethernet connection instead of WiFi for more stable access
Factory Reset Steps for Verizon Routers
If you’ve forgotten the admin password or need to restore default settings, perform a factory reset:
- Locate the Reset button on your Verizon router, typically found on the back panel.
- While the router is powered on, use a paperclip or needle to press and hold the Reset button.
- Hold the button for 10-15 seconds until the LED lights begin blinking.
- Release the Reset button and wait for the router to fully reboot.
- All customized settings will be restored to factory defaults, including passwords and WiFi configurations.
